摘要
A comprehensive summary of research work related to applications of NMR spectroscopy in combination with multivariate statistical analysis techniques for the analysis, quality control, and authentication of wine is presented. NMR spectroscopy is used to obtain the non-volatile metabolic profile and/or phenolic profile of wines, with the help of 2D NMR spectroscopy. Metabolomics is then used as an analytical tool to investigate the variability of the metabolic profile of wines due to a series of different factors involved during wine production, including terroir, pedoclimatic conditions, vintage, vineyard practices, wine-making, barrel maturation, and aging. The discriminating power of the NMR-obtained wine metabolome is utilized as a wholistic analytical approach in efforts to authenticate wine with respect to important economic attributes, such as cultivar, vintage, and geographical origin.Graphical abstract.[graphic not available: see fulltext]
